What Can Fix Uneven Teeth?
Orthodontic measures to straighten and correct crowding and crooked teeth come in two main types – traditional and modern methods.
- Traditional measures
- Metal braces
- Clear braces
- Damon braces
- Lingual braces
- Modern measures
- Clear Aligners

Advantages of Clear Aligners
- Cost: Clear aligners tend to cost less than traditional braces.
- Convenience: They also have direct-to-consumer options that allow the customer to send the selling company molds of their teeth. These molds are then used to build a custom-made clear aligner. A remote evaluation is also available. Clear aligners don’t need in-office
- treatments with orthodontists as much as a traditional treatment.
- Speed: Clear aligners are usually faster at doing their job. They take 8-16 weeks to align teeth if the user wears the aligner for a considerable amount of time every day.
- Risk: They also are less liable to cause complications such as root resorption.
- Removability: The Inman Aligner has the advantage of being removed when one doesn’t need to use it. This is hugely helpful. One can take it out before eating, brushing one’s teeth, and sleeping. One can also wash the aligner in a seamless manner.
Clear aligners come in many types. Examples are Invisalign aligner and Inman aligners. Invisalign aligners are a more expensive option, usually costing double of Inman Aligners, up to £4,000.
These products often come with professional assessments that cost £200-300.
It is advised one takes these assessments to confirm if one needs an aligner.
For the purposes of affordability, we will discuss the Inman Aligner further. It is an ideal choice for individuals who cannot afford lengthy, traditional treatments. Inman Aligners work through constant pressure applied on the teeth as seen here.
The Costs of Inman Aligners
- The whole treatment of the Inman Aligner can cost anything from £1,400 to £2,000 for a single arc of teeth.
- If one is correcting a double arc of teeth – i.e. the top and bottom front teeth – then it can cost as much as £3,200, including a full retainer and a full case assessment.
- Paid plans can also include a monthly 12-month plan with no interest or a monthly 60-month plan with 10% interest. For single arc treatment, it can costs £125 per month for a year or £29 per month for 60 months, at 10% interest.
What To Keep In Mind Before Buying?
There are important questions one must ask themselves before making a decision.
What is the main objective of the treatment?
Is it straightening your teeth for aesthetic purposes? For example an upcoming wedding? Is it because you have an overbite? Or an underbite? Does chewing your food have difficulties because of either? Do you also need whitening to go with it?
How much are you willing to pay?
Are you willing to try a treatment that includes a full assessment along with the Inman Aligner? Or have you already done an assessment with your dentist? Is it for your upper front teeth, lower front teeth, or both? To do both will cost double than that of either one.
Do you want to do the mold at home or at a company shop?
There are choices on how you can go about getting the treatment.
- You can call the company and request a mold taken at home. Company professionals will take a mold of your teeth at home and use it to create a custom-made aligner. They will send you the aligner and its retainers by mail. This method might cost more.
- Or you can go to the shop to get your mouth scanned in 3-D, with an intraoral scanner. They will garner a custom model of your mouth and either deliver or ask you to pick it up from an outlet in a few days.
